Augustamine type alkaloids from Crinum kirkii.

Alex K Machocho1, Jaume Bastida, Carlos Codina, Francesc Viladomat, Reto Brun, Sumesh C Chhabra.   

Abstract

Sixteen more Amaryllidaceae alkaloids have been isolated from bulbs of Crinum kirkii Baker of which noraugustamine and 4a,N-dedihydronoraugustamine are hitherto unknown. Their structures and those of earlier known alkaloids have been established by physical and spectroscopic analysis. Application of 2D NMR techniques was used for complete characterization of the alkaloids as well as of 3-O-acetylsanguinine. 1,2-Diacetyllycorine and 3-O-acetylsanguinine showed activity against Trypanosoma brucci rhodesiense, the parasite associated with sleeping sickness. 3-O-acetylsanguinine also showed some activity against Trypanosoma cruzi.
